MATLAB是一种功能强大的编程语言和计算软件,广泛应用于各种科学和工程领域。在海洋水文学中,利用MATLAB来绘制水文函数图像是一项非常有用的技能。通过可视化水文函数,我们可以更好地理解和分析海洋环境中的水文现象。在本文中,我将介绍如何利用MATLAB绘制海洋水文函数图像。
5 Q2 z2 u- r( T
: w% [, e' i- i4 X首先,我们需要了解海洋水文学中常用的一些水文函数,例如温度-盐度图、深度-温度图、深度-盐度图等。这些函数描述了海洋中不同物理量之间的关系,对于研究海洋环境和气候变化具有重要意义。使用MATLAB绘制这些函数图像可以使我们更直观地观察到这些关系。* y+ N7 w2 F. X
. T; J( V) }( {在MATLAB中,我们可以使用plot函数来绘制水文函数图像。例如,如果我们想绘制温度-盐度图,可以将温度作为x轴,盐度作为y轴,然后使用plot函数绘制数据点。这些数据点可以通过实际测量数据或模拟结果获得。通过将所有的数据点连接起来,我们就可以得到温度-盐度图。
( s0 @, |1 b: c
! y+ x Z0 _# K) K+ X+ ~0 }& B, a除了使用plot函数,MATLAB还提供了许多其他绘图函数,如contour函数和surf函数。这些函数可以绘制等值线图和三维曲面图,更全面地展示水文函数的特征。
4 W/ v& h7 k* N( ^8 o+ n
! M' H, Y" l: a除了基本的绘图函数,MATLAB还提供了丰富的工具箱和函数,用于处理海洋水文数据。例如,可以使用MATLAB的统计工具箱来进行数据处理和分析,从而得到更准确和有意义的水文函数图像。此外,MATLAB还提供了各种绘图样式和选项,可以自定义绘图的外观和风格,使其更加美观和易读。: c9 M* N( s3 q# q7 i+ k0 r
0 Q ?3 c- G* C7 J8 J在实际应用中,我们可能需要对大量的数据进行处理和分析。MATLAB提供了强大的矩阵运算功能,可以高效地处理大规模数据集。此外,MATLAB还支持并行计算,可以利用多核处理器来加速计算过程,提高绘图的效率。6 \9 G3 t( Y! ^2 H% y
& P \/ e2 W( h当我们完成了水文函数图像的绘制后,可以使用MATLAB的导出功能将图像保存为各种格式,如PNG、JPEG和PDF等。这样我们就可以方便地将图像用于研究报告、学术论文和演示文稿中。8 n* e @* o6 ?+ B# ~9 r
* \8 k0 A! U% N* C总之,利用MATLAB绘制海洋水文函数图像是一项非常有用的技能。通过可视化水文函数,我们可以更好地理解和分析海洋环境中的水文现象。MATLAB提供了丰富的绘图函数、工具箱和函数,可以帮助我们高效地处理和分析海洋水文数据,并生成美观和有意义的图像。希望本文能帮助您在海洋水文学中更好地使用MATLAB。谢谢! |